Check Digit Verification of cas no

The CAS Registry Mumber 22627-45-8 includes 8 digits separated into 3 groups by hyphens. The first part of the number,starting from the left, has 5 digits, 2,2,6,2 and 7 respectively; the second part has 2 digits, 4 and 5 respectively.
Calculate Digit Verification of CAS Registry Number 22627-45:
(7*2)+(6*2)+(5*6)+(4*2)+(3*7)+(2*4)+(1*5)=98
98 % 10 = 8
So 22627-45-8 is a valid CAS Registry Number.

Formation of quaternary chiral centers by N-Heterocyclic carbene-CuCatalyzed asymmetric conjugate addition reactions with grignard reagents on trisubstituted cyclic enones

Kehrli, Stefan,Martin, David,Rix, Diane,Mauduit, Marc,Alexakis, Alexandre

supporting information; experimental part, p. 9890 - 9904 (2010/11/04)

The copper-catalyzed conjugate addition of Grignard reagents to 3-substituted cyclic enones allows the formation of all-carbon chiral quaternary centers. We demonstrate in this article that N-heterocyclic carbenes act as efficient chiral ligands for this transformation. High enantioselectivities (up to 96% ee) could be obtained for a variety of substrates.

Stereoselective aziridination of cyclic allylic alcohols using chloramine-T

Coote, Susannah C.,O'Brien, Peter,Whitwood, Adrian C.

supporting information; experimental part, p. 4299 - 4314 (2009/02/07)

The stereoselective aziridination of a range of cyclic allylic alcohols using two different chloramine salts (4-MeC6H4SO 2NClNa, TsNClNa and t-BuSO2NClNa, BusNClNa) has been explored. The stereoselectivity of these reactions was highly dependent on the structure of the allylic alcohol and the chloramine salt. Generally, mixtures of cis- and trans-hydroxy aziridines were obtained, in which the major diastereomer was the cis-hydroxy aziridine, whilst complete cis- diastereoselectivity was observed in the aziridination of 1,3-disubstituted allylic alcohols. In each case studied, aziridination using BusNClNa gave higher cis-stereoselectivity than that observed for the same reaction using TsNClNa. Unexpectedly, application of the aziridination conditions to 1-substituted cyclopen-2-en-1-ols did not generate the aziridines. Instead, epoxy sulfonamides were obtained.

Copper-catalyzed asymmetric conjugate addition of trialkylaluminium reagents to trisubstituted enones: Construction of chiral quaternary centers

Vuagnoux-D'Augustin, Magali,Alexakis, Alexandre

, p. 9647 - 9662 (2008/12/21)

Me3Al, Et1Al, and vinylalane species undergo enantioselective conjugate addition to a wide range of 2- or 3-substituted enones (cyclopent-2enones, cyclohex-2-enones, 3-methyl cyclohept-2-enone) in the presence of catalytic amount of copper salt (copper thiophene carboxylate, [Cu(CH3-CN)4]BF4 or [CuOTf]2· C6H6) and tropos-phosphoramidite-based ligand. Thus, chiral quaternary centers can be built, with up to 98% ee after rigorous optimization of experimental conditions. It was shown that the main important parameter was the order of the introduction of the reagents. Then, the generated enantioenriched aluminium enolates and the chiral conjugate adducts were functionalized and used for subsequent reactions.

Tandem Photocyclization-Intramolecular Addition Reactions of Aryl Vinyl Sulfides. Observation of a Novel Cycloaddition-Allylic Sulfide Rearrangement

Dittami, James P.,Nie, Xiao Yi,Nie, Hong,Ramanathan, H.,Buntel, C.,et al.

, p. 1151 - 1158 (2007/10/02)

Photocyclization of aryl vinyl sulfides reportedly proceeds via thiocarbonyl ylide intermediates.The photochemical behavior of several aryl vinyl sulfides, which incorporate a pendant alkene side chain, was explored.In general, naphthyl and phenyl vinyl thioethers provided products which are consistent with photocyclization to a thiocarbonyl ylide intermediate followed by either intramolecular hydrogen shift or subsequent intramolecular ylide-alkene addition.Product distribution is influenced by solvent and and temperature effects.Novel secondary photoprocesses were also observed during some reactions.Thus, irradiation of naphthyl vinyl sulfide 20 gave dihydrothiophene 22 which underwent subsequent intramolecular cycloaddition to provide 24.Upon prolonged irradiation 24 undergoes a novel allylic sulfide rearrangement to provide 25.

Stereoselective Synthesis of (+/-)-Indolizidines 167B, 205A, and 207A. Enantioselective Synthesis of (-)-Indolizidine 209B

Holmes, Andrew B.,Smith, Adrian L.,Williams, Simon F.,Hughes, Leslie R.,Lidert, Zev,Swithenbank, Colin

, p. 1393 - 1405 (2007/10/02)

The first syntheses of the dendrobatid indolizidine alkaloids 167B (3), 205A (4), and 207A (5) are described using as a key step the highly stereoselective intramolecular nitrone cycloaddition of the (Z)-N-alkenylnitrone 10 to prepare the isoxazolidine 11.Mesylate-promoted cyclization of the alcohol 12, followed by reductive cleavage of the resulting mesylate salt, afforded the key axial hydroxymethyl compound 13, which was epimerized via the aldehyde to the equatorial alcohol, and was subsequently reduced to the required 8-methyl-substituted indolizidine.The feasibility of extending this strategy to the enantioselective synthesis of such alkaloids was demonstrated in the first synthesis of (-)-indolizidine 209B (6), whose precursor 10d was obtained from the (S)-glutamate-derived amine 40.
